Nanosecond voltage transducer

Description

The capacitor voltage transducer operating in high-voltage devices with liquid dielectric materials and ensuring pulse rise time of 2 ns and that of pileup being equal to 13 μs is described. The transducer high-voltage arm is formed by the capacitance between the transducer electrode and high-voltage electrode; the dielectric material between them is purified water with specific resistance of 0.05-0.1 MΩxm. As the low-voltage arm the foil capacitor with capacitance of 20-25 nF is used. The described transducer ensures the accuracy of voltage measuring not worse than 3% and is used in the ANGARA-5 experimental module for measuring transient processes
